Just got back home about 15 minutes ago. Took A LOT of pics.. and I am super tanned (kind of burnt)

First couple days were teh suck because I was so sick. I vomited either the first night, or second night.

Otherwise, it was amazing. Beautiful beaches, beautiful people (Dominican people are so amazing... and the men are sexerific) and amazing weather. I am sad to be back in Canada.

quote:
Originally posted by Ivand
for gods sake, no, there are no market tents selling cooked dogs, and seems like you have not been on downtown santo domingo for a while


I went to the capital of the province - Higuey, and a couple of other small towns on the way. Yes, it is very poor (compared to North America), and there are a lot of things that are going on that are really different from the western norm. I also noticed that it is very dirty. Garbage is EVERYWHERE. I am assuming that they don't have a very strong garbage disposal program in place. I have never seen so much garbage in my life.

The city of Higuey was so large! They have their street lamps disguised as palm trees, which I thought was pretty cool. They also have a super massive church right in the middle of the city. We were told that the doors to the church cost 2 million dollars. From what it seemed, there is an upcoming election, and the Dominican people are very politically involved. There were huge crowds with flags and signs lobbying others to vote for a specific president. Ivan?

Aside from the garbage, the country was magnificent. White sandy beaches, beautiful vegetation, hot weather with barely any rain, some pretty mountains, and did I mention the amazing beaches?

Things I did:

Drove a speedboat (omg so much fun)
Snorkeled
Boated (Catamarans, speedboats and a paddle boat lol)
Tanned
Danced
Rode on a crazy open concept bus and hung out the back of it
Went to Higuey
Traveled to Saona Island
Went to a "Caribbean swimming pool", which is a sandbar in the middle of the water the is so warm, and shallow. This is where we saw starfish.

I didn't do as much as I was hoping to, but being sick really had me dragging my ass for the first few days.

I got a lot of R&R in, which was nice, and highly needed.

In the future, I would never travel ill again. The pressure in my ears was horrible on the plane, and feeling kind of blah when you can't be in your own bed isn't very pleasant.
